Part or all of these rides will be be on road so normal packdrill required
HHYCC/DP and BC membership required
Bring spare inner tubes
Do a bike check prior to leaving
Wear suitable clothes for the season
Food (snacks - not 4 course lunch) and liquid
Telephone number of your parent/rescuer in your back pocket.
All this should fit in pockets in your jersey - no suitcases pls.
